How Has the Chevy Tahoe Transformed Over the Last Decade?

Design and Exterior Changes Let’s start by exploring the evolution of the Chevy Tahoe’s exterior and design. Chevy has made substantial efforts to keep this SUV looking and feeling relevant, making it appeal to a wide variety of consumers. Nowhere is this more evident than in the Tahoe’s external aesthetics. A Modern Facelift When you look back at Tahoe models from the early 2010s, you will see that this SUV had a design that embodies ruggedness, given its imposing stature and boxy shape. For the time, this was fairly typical of SUVs, but consumer preferences soon changed. When that happened, Chevy had to adjust the Tahoe’s appearance to embrace more streamlined and aerodynamic design factors. Chevy made the Tahoe look more modern and slimmer, giving it more undulating lines, an aerodynamic front grille, and LED lighting. Lighter Materials Over time, Chevy has incorporated lighter—but just as durable—materials into the body construction of the Tahoe; the objective is to improve fuel economy without sacrificing strength or safety. High-strength steel and aluminum are used in multiple components to help reduce the vehicle’s weight, making this SUV more fuel-efficient and agile in terms of handling. Wheel and Tire Options The Tahoe’s wheel and tire options have also altered over the last decade, expanding to include many more choices. This allows customers to personalize their Tahoe to their liking, letting them choose from the standard wheel designs to bigger, more eye-catching selections. Overall, the exterior’s customizability has seriously improved, so you can make a new Tahoe truly your own. Interior Comfort and Technology The Chevy Tahoe’s extreme makeover does not stop at its exterior—far from it. The Tahoe’s interior reflects tremendous advancements in terms of technology and comfort. Upgraded Materials and Finishes There was once a time when the Tahoe’s cabin was criticized for its lack of refinement. Chevy took these critiques to heart and remedied this problem by adding high-quality materials, more attention to detail, and plusher finishes. Contemporary Tahoes come with metal or wood accents, cozy leather seats, and many soft-touch surfaces, resulting in a more comfortable and welcoming cabin. Infotainment Systems Chevy is hard at work each year, pushing technological advances to the limit. Today’s models come with huge touchscreen displays that showcase user-friendly interfaces. There are plenty of connectivity options, including smartphone app integration via Apple CarPlay and Android Auto. Your passengers can also enjoy navigation, entertainment, and smartphone app integration. Advanced Driver Assistance Features Safety features and driver aids are also massively improved compared to what you would get on a Tahoe from the early 2010s. From blind-spot monitoring to adaptive cruise control, from lane keep assist to automatic emergency braking, the newer Tahoes offer a wider variety of safety tech to keep you and your passengers safe while on the go. Once rather limited (or even non-existent) on the Tahoe, these features now come in abundance, with more being standardized each passing year. Performance and Fuel Efficiency Over the past decade, Chevy has diligently worked to beef up the Tahoe’s performance and fuel efficiency. The result is an SUV that's more practical and versatile, appealing to a wider array of drivers. Engine Options One of the biggest enhancements in recent years has been the introduction of multiple engine options. Older Tahoes were known for their powerful V8 engines, which are still available, but Chevy has added smaller, more fuel-savvy engines, including turbocharged and V6 variants. This lets consumers choose the engine that best caters to their driving style and needs. Hybrid Technology Automotive trends are largely shifting toward electrification, and Chevy isn’t just riding that bandwagon—they’re driving it! Hybrid technology now comes on the Tahoe’s lineup with a hybrid powertrain that offers enhanced fuel economy and reduces your vehicle’s carbon footprint. Hybrid technology simply wasn’t available in the earlier Tahoe iterations, and it is largely a welcome addition. Transmission and Suspension Chevy has pushed technology forward for the suspension and transmission systems as well. Newer models have more advanced and efficient transmissions that lead to higher fuel economy. What’s more, the Tahoe’s suspension has been fine-tuned for a more comfortable and smoother ride quality that does not sacrifice this SUV’s strong off-road capabilities. Towing and Utility As an SUV, the Chevy Tahoe has always stood out for its utility and towing capacity. Within the last ten years, Chevy has taken the initiative to offer more cargo space with extra versatility and, of course, higher max towing capacities. Newer Tahoes come with towing tech—such as integrated trailer brake controllers, trailer sway control, and a wide rearview camera—to make towing easier and safer than ever before. Fuel Efficiency and Sustainability As environmental concerns grow, Chevrolet has been keen on improving the fuel efficiency and sustainability of the Tahoe, making it more appealing to a broader range of consumers. Environmental concerns continue to expand, and Chevy is keen on improving the sustainability and fuel efficiency of their vehicles, including the Tahoe. You will find that cylinder deactivation is now standard to improve fuel efficiency; when you cruise under a light load or at lower speeds, the engine will deactivate specific cylinders, thereby reducing fuel consumption. Another feature you won’t find in older Tahoes is start-stop technology. This automatically shuts the engine off when the vehicle is stationary, lessening its idling time and conserving fuel. As soon as you take your foot off the brake pedal, the engine effortlessly restarts so you can go. Flex fuel variants of the Tahoe have become available in recent years, running on ethanol, which is more sustainable than gasoline. Of course, the aforementioned hybrid powertrain is also available, showing Chevy’s commitment to sustainability.
